In a detailed order rejecting the discharge pleas of three doctors accused of abetting the 2019 suicide of their junior, Dr Payal Tadvi, by harassing her over her caste, a special court observed that had they filed the pleas only to prolong trial. The court said there is prima-facie sufficient material on their participation and specific role in regard to accusations against them, and they certainly do not deserve to be discharged from the crime levelled against them.
